Crews responded to a report that a car was on its side with a person trapped inside it around 3:35 p.m. in front of the Ross Dress For Less at 650 River St., officials said.

When firefighters arrived, they freed the woman from her car and transported her to Dominican Hospital, according to officials. 

The extent of the woman’s injuries are unknown. She was the only one hurt.

Police said the accident is still under investigation.
